Top 5 Mal Descendants Characters Shaping Villainy

1. Mal (Daughter of Maleficent)

Mal isn’t just your average villain’s kid; she’s the poster girl for growth and challenges. Mal struggles with living up to her mother’s notorious reputation, a battle that speaks volumes to anyone feeling the weight of their lineage. With a mix of fierce determination and a sprinkle of self-doubt, Mal embodies the essence of character evolution. She’s relatable—trust us! Her journey represents anyone trying to forge their path against the shadows of their past. Who hasn’t felt a bit overshadowed at some point in their lives? Less “once upon a time” and more “let’s figure this out,” Mal is a character for the ages.

2. Evie (Daughter of the Evil Queen)

If you thought Evie was just glitter and glam, think again! She evolves from a princess obsessed with looks to a powerful player in the game of alliances. Her journey isn’t just a makeover; it’s about using wits and charm to become a fierce ally rather than a rival. Evie’s arc signifies the reinvention of female villainy, challenging the traditional narratives while injecting a dose of modern feminism into Disney’s legacy. Rather than hating on one another, Evie sparks the idea that collaboration wins over competition. Who wouldn’t want a friend like that, right?

4. Carlos (Son of Cruella de Vil)

Carlos is adorable, and we’d be lying if we didn’t say his love for animals adds complexity to his character. Growing up with a notorious villain like Cruella can’t be easy! Rather than following in his mother’s footsteps, Carlos chooses a noble path—one that leans towards compassion. His struggle for self-acceptance poses intriguing questions about individuality and morality. Ultimately, he proves that you don’t have to be defined by your origins. Isn’t that a lesson for us all? Talk about redefining what it means to inherit a villainous legacy!
